Cost

Many of the newest models of cars use keys that have transponder chips that must be programmed in order to work. While it is possible to duplicate and program these kinds of keys by yourself It is recommended to hire locksmiths who are member of the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). These experts possess the knowledge and expertise to successfully copy your key and then program it to ensure it can work with your vehicle. In addition to cutting and programming your key, a locksmith can also assist in removing broken keys from the lock cylinder and replace them.

The cost of having a new key cut and programmed is contingent on the kind you require. Basic keys can be duplicated in just a few minutes, but fobs or remote starter key units may take up to an hour. In general, Car Key cut and programed key duplication costs vary from $25 to $100. This includes the price of the key, labor to cut it, as well as a charge to program the key to your car.

Car key programming is a process that involves programming a blank chip into the car key you are replacing. These chips are a part of the security systems in modern automobiles and can only be read by computers when correctly introduced. This ensures that only the correct key is used, and also prevents thieves from using stolen car keys to start vehicles.

There are several ways to do car key programming, however the easiest and fastest is onboard programming. Most auto dealerships can perform this service, however an authentic car key is required. Other methods, like OBD2 and EEPROM programming are more complicated and require specialized tools.

Peugeot-2021-New-Black.pngMost cars come with a transponder chip that has to be programmed. These chips are part of the immobilizer system in the majority of cars and can prevent theft when they are inserted into the ignition or door lock. The computer can only read this message if the alternating sequence of security codes matches the key.
